    Sam Loyd

    Samuel Loyd (1841 – 1911), born in Philadelphia and raised in New York City, was an American chess player, chess composer, puzzle author, and recreational mathematician. As a chess composer, he authored a number of chess problems, often with interesting themes. At his peak, Loyd was one of the best chess players in the US and was ranked 15th in the world, according to chessmetrics.com.

    Fastest Stalemate

    Section: Brain Teasers Category: Chess
    Difficulty: Expert

    Can you design a chess game that ends up with a stalemate in the 10th move?

    SOLUTION

    One possible game is:

    1. h4 h5
    2. c4 a5
    3. Qa4 Ra6
    4. Qxa5 Rah6
    5. Qxc7 f6
    6. Qxd7 Kf7
    7. Qxb7 Qd3
    8. Qxb8 Qh7
    9. Qxc8 Kg6
    10. Qe6

    Puzzle Sum 20

    Section: Casual Puzzles Category: Rebus
    Difficulty: Easy

    What two American cities do these sums spell?

    SOLUTION

    SEAT + CATTLE – CAT = SEATTLE
    BOY + AWL – YAWL + STONE – E = BOSTON

    Puzzle Sum 18

    Section: Casual Puzzles Category: Rebus
    Difficulty: Easy

    What two American cities do these puzzle sums represent?

    SOLUTION

    NEST + ONE – STONE + WHEEL – HEEL + ARK = NEWARK
    WHEEL + PIE + RING – PIER = WHEELING
